Freigeben über


CompiledPageActionDescriptorProvider Klasse

Definition

Eine IActionDescriptorProvider für die Buildzeit kompilierte Razor Pages.

public sealed class CompiledPageActionDescriptorProvider : Microsoft.AspNetCore.Mvc.Abstractions.IActionDescriptorProvider
type CompiledPageActionDescriptorProvider = class
    interface IActionDescriptorProvider
Public NotInheritable Class CompiledPageActionDescriptorProvider
Implements IActionDescriptorProvider
Vererbung
CompiledPageActionDescriptorProvider
Implementiert

Konstruktoren

CompiledPageActionDescriptorProvider(IEnumerable<IPageRouteModelProvider>, IEnumerable<IPageApplicationModelProvider>, ApplicationPartManager, IOptions<MvcOptions>, IOptions<RazorPagesOptions>)

Initialisiert eine neue Instanz von CompiledPageActionDescriptorProvider.

Eigenschaften

Order

Ruft den Auftragswert zum Bestimmen der Ausführungsreihenfolge von Anbietern ab. Anbieter führen im aufsteigenden numerischen Wert der Order Eigenschaft aus.

Methoden

OnProvidersExecuted(ActionDescriptorProviderContext)

Wird aufgerufen, um den Anbieter auszuführen, nachdem die OnProvidersExecuting(ActionDescriptorProviderContext) Methoden aller Anbieter aufgerufen wurden. Order für Details zur Ausführungsreihenfolge von OnProvidersExecuted(ActionDescriptorProviderContext).

OnProvidersExecuting(ActionDescriptorProviderContext)

Wird aufgerufen, um den Anbieter auszuführen. Order für Details zur Ausführungsreihenfolge von OnProvidersExecuting(ActionDescriptorProviderContext).

Gilt für: